2009-11-08 7 views
2

MVC 개념을 사용하여 작성된 웹 응용 프로그램을 생각해 봅시다. 내 응용 프로그램이 사용자 입력 및 데이터베이스를 기반으로 동적으로 차트 이미지를 생성하는 경우 이미지 생성 프로세스가 속한 구성 요소 (컨트롤러 또는보기)를 알고 싶습니다.MVC 관련 질문

컨트롤러와 이미지를 생성하기 위해 이미지를 표시하는보기 구성 요소가 있습니까?

답변

2

네,하지만 난 컨트롤러

1

당신이 올바른지를 호출 할 것이다 차트를 생성하는 클래스를 만들 것, 컨트롤러는 이미지를 생성해야하고 뷰가 표시되어야합니다. 이것은 이진 데이터를 스트리밍하는 컨트롤러/디스패치에 이미지의 "src"속성을 설정하여 처리 할 가능성이 높지만,이를 구현하는 방법은 사용자에게 달려 있습니다.

1

컨트롤러는 이미지 생성을 조정합니다. 이미지는 HttpHandler, 스트림을 생성 할 수있는 다른 구성 요소 또는 리턴되어야하는 정적 자원에 의해 생성 될 수 있습니다.

기타 답변에 대한 추가 정보는 an example입니다.